Overview of this book

Adobe Captivate Prime is an enterprise learning management system (LMS) that enables organizations to deliver, manage, and track engaging learning experiences for employees, partners, and customers. This book will help you unlock the full potential of this platform to deliver world-class learning experiences. Complete with walkthroughs, examples, and strategies to fully understand Captivate Prime, this book will set you on the path to becoming an administrator, author, or teacher and see you experiment with Captivate Prime from different perspectives. You'll gain an in-depth understanding of how the features relate to one another and to your business. After setting up the platform, you'll learn how to push learning content online and arrange it to build an online course that provides a blended learning experience. You'll be able to deploy your content to different devices and explore Captivate Prime's features for monitoring your students' progress on a daily basis. Finally, you'll see how to organize and maintain your course catalog and take the learner experience to the next level. By the end of the book, you’ll be able to implement your organization’s training strategy and provide engaging learning experiences while building meaningful reports to monitor their effectiveness.

Chapter 5: Managing Users

After reading the previous chapter, there is learning content hosted on your Prime account. This content is ready to be delivered to your learners. Except... you don't have any learners yet! In this chapter, you will review the tools and features of Captivate Prime that allow you to manage the users that will be granted access to your Prime account.

When it comes to user management, there are two important aspects to keep in mind: authentication and authorization. Authentication answers the question, "Who are you?", while authorization answers the question, "What can you do?"

For authentication, you can, of course, define users directly within Captivate Prime. But as the enterprise LMS of choice, Captivate Prime understands that users may already be defined in a corporate directory, an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) or a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system, and so on.
